The technology
Four waves that everybody treated as four bets, and that turned out to be one.

01
Web3
Value that moves without an intermediaryThe first wave established that a ledger could be a shared source of truth between parties who do not trust each other. Everything the group later built on settlement descends from that, and so does the habit of publishing the record rather than asserting it.

02
The metaverse
Places that persist, and property inside themThe second wave turned out to be about property law more than graphics: who owns a parcel, what tenure means when the landlord is a company, and what a world is worth when its operator can change the rules. The group bought, held, wrote down and sold real positions here, and kept the reference works.

03
AI
Agents that act rather than answerThe third wave supplied the actor. Once software could decide and not merely compute, the open question stopped being capability and became authority — what an agent may do, on whose behalf, and who is accountable when it is wrong. That question is the group’s standard.

04
Robotics
Agents with a body, and consequencesThe fourth wave puts the agent into the physical world, where a mistake costs something irreversible. The group’s published assessment says the field scores 0.67 out of 3 on authority and 0.17 on settlement: machines can move, and almost none of them can be trusted with anything or paid for what they did.
Web4 is the convergence: worlds that are persistent, agents that are autonomous, machines that are embodied, and value that settles between them without a person in the loop. Each earlier wave supplied a piece the next one could not have built for itself — which is why arriving early to all four was not diversification. It was one position, held for a decade.

03
KBA
Kerala Blockchain AcademyThe step from student network to state institution. Founded in 2017 as a centre of excellence under Kerala University of Digital Sciences, KBA has since trained more than 33,500 people across 66 countries — and it is a content partner of the Blockchain Education Network, which makes the link between this stage and the last one an actual institutional relationship rather than a chronology. Convening had become something a government builds on.

The model
The same four steps, taken deliberately, in the only order that works.
-
01
Advise
Sell judgmentThe cheapest way to see a market from the inside is to be paid to have an opinion about it. Advisory generates no assets and enormous information, and the information is the point.
-
02
Agency
Sell executionDoing the work rather than describing it. Agency revenue is unglamorous and it funds everything: it pays for the team, and it reveals which problems are structural rather than particular to one client.
-
03
Invest
Take a position instead of a feeThe first step where the upside is not capped by a rate card. It is also the first step that requires being wrong in public, and the record of that — including the write-offs — is published rather than curated.
-
04
Own
Hold the thing itself, permanentlyThe end of the sequence. Not a fund with a horizon but a balance sheet with none, holding infrastructure the rest of the group depends on. The three arcs meet here.
Each step is funded by the one before it and impossible without it. Advice buys the reputation that wins agency work; agency work buys the cash and the pattern recognition that make investing possible; investing buys the positions that make ownership meaningful. A group that starts at "own" has to buy what this one was paid to learn.
Why the estate
34 properties are worth more than 34 sites, and the difference is not a slogan.
A group of unrelated companies that happen to share an owner is a portfolio. This is not that. Every property inherits six things from the estate on the day it launches, and each one is a cost it does not pay and an advantage it does not have to earn.
One identity layer
Every property delegates authority through the same grant kernel, so a person or an agent authenticated in one is known to all of them. One auth system per property would be one liability per property.
One settlement record
Value that moves between properties settles on one ledger with one public invariant. Cross-property economics are auditable rather than reconciled.
One standard
Every organisation publishes the same machine-readable charter at the same path. An agent that can read one property can read all of them, and the specification is open so it can read anyone else who adopts it.
One link architecture
A claim has exactly one canonical home and every other property links to it. Authority concentrates instead of dispersing, and a new property inherits the standing of the ones already there.
One brand system
One kit, vendored with drift tests. A new property is recognisable on the day it launches rather than after a year of building its own equity.
One register
Every property, its state, its dependencies and its accountable human, in one file that renders the site and the machine surfaces together. The estate cannot describe itself inaccurately without failing a test.
That is the digital-estate argument in full: property number 34 is cheaper to launch and worth more on arrival than the first one was, because it inherits identity, settlement, a standard, a link graph, a brand and a register that the 33 before it already paid for. Coherent intellectual property compounds. A collection does not.
